Kemari, lead singer for Sunset Ride, has recorded 4 albums. The first two as lead vocalist for the duo Hearts Gone Wild. "Changes" (produced by Tom Jones) and "Faster" (produced by Rod Riley). The third album "Peace in the Valley", (also produced by Tom Jones), Rawlings recorded with the "Peteetneet Creek Ranch Hands". On this album, she sang and played mandolin. Her fourth, "A Deeper Red" produced by Rod Riley is her most current project and is available on iTunes. Proceeds from the "Red" album continue to be donated to benefit children with autism.

On Sunset Ride's web page, the following singles can be heard: Little Get-a-way, That's Me, and Hey Sunshine.

Sunset Ride was formed in the spring of 2009 by Kemari Rawlings, a hot lead vocalist with Nashville ties. She was looking for local talent to support her in promoting her latest c.d. release, "A Deeper Red."

She didn't have to look farther than her back yard. Every member of Sunset Ride lives in Santaquin, Utah.

Sunset Ride has performed at the Utah State Fair, the Utah County Fair, corporate events, various city celebrations, and for many private functions.

Sunset Ride's music is influenced by great performers such as Shania Twain, Gretchen Wilson, Martina McBride, The Eagles, and Journey.

The original songs are catchy and really fun to listen and dance to.
